Understanding the Role of Thabet in Software Development
In the rapidly evolving landscape of technology, the role of Thabet in software development has emerged as pivotal. As organizations strive for innovation, Thabet embodies a fusion of best practices and cutting-edge methodologies that both streamline processes and enhance output quality. With the rise of agile methodologies, microservices architecture, and CI/CD practices, Thabet stands out as an approach that fosters collaboration and speeds up delivery timelines. This article delves into the innovative software design patterns, best practices for scalable architecture, and successful implementations that exemplify the impact of Thabet in modern software development.
Innovative Software Design Patterns Utilized by Thabet
One of the hallmarks of Thabet’s approach is the employment of innovative software design patterns that cater to the varying needs of applications. Design patterns such as Model-View-Controller (MVC), Singleton, and Factory patterns are frequently utilized within Thabet architectures due to their proven effectiveness in organizing codebase, ensuring maintainability, and improving scalability.
- Model-View-Controller (MVC): This pattern separates application logic from the user interface, enhancing the manageability of large projects.
- Singleton: Ensures that a class has only one instance while providing a global point of access, ideal for configuration settings.
- Factory Pattern: Facilitates instantiation of objects based on a set of criteria, encapsulating the creation logic and promoting loose coupling.
Best Practices for Scalable Thabet Architecture
Scalability is crucial in today’s digital economy. Thabet practices recommend several strategies for achieving scalable architecture:
- Microservices Architecture: By breaking applications into smaller, independent services that can be deployed separately, organizations can scale components horizontally based on demand.
- Containerization: Utilizing tools like Docker, developers can package applications and their dependencies into containers, making the deployment process seamless and more consistent across different environments.
- Serverless Computing: Leveraging platforms like AWS Lambda allows developers to focus solely on building functionalities without worrying about server management, thus promoting cost efficiency and scalability.
Case Studies: Successful Thabet Implementations
Real-world applications of Thabet principles illuminate its effectiveness across various industries:
- Healthcare IT Solutions: A leading healthcare provider implemented Thabet-inspired microservices, resulting in a 30% reduction in system downtime and accelerated patient data processing.
- Retail Platforms: A prominent retail chain adopted a Thabet architecture, which enabled seamless integration of their promotional services, improving user engagement by 45% through personalized recommendations.
- Financial Services: By employing serverless technologies, a banking institution streamlined transaction processing, achieving a significant cost reduction while enhancing transaction speed and reliability.
Thabet and Cloud Computing: A Game Changer
The integration of Thabet with cloud computing technologies has dramatically transformed how businesses operate. Cloud computing provides the backbone for Thabet solutions by offering essential services that enhance both agility and efficiency. Companies are increasingly leveraging AWS, Azure, and Google Cloud to deploy their Thabet architectures, capitalizing on their extensive features to drive innovation.
Leveraging AWS Services for Thabet Efficiency
Amazon Web Services (AWS) offers a broad range of services that can be integrated within the Thabet framework to enhance operational effectiveness:
- AWS Lambda: Allows for serverless computing, enabling developers to execute code without provisioning servers.
- Amazon S3: Offers scalable storage solutions, handy for enterprises requiring substantial data storage.
- AWS Elastic Beanstalk: Facilitates easy deployment and management of applications in the cloud, significantly easing operations.
Cloud Security Protocols Essential for Thabet Platforms
Security is paramount when deploying Thabet architectures in the cloud. Organizations must adopt stringent cloud security protocols to protect sensitive data and maintain compliance with industry standards:
- Data Encryption: Implementing encryption both at rest and in transit safeguards data integrity and confidentiality.
- Identity and Access Management (IAM): Establishing robust IAM policies ensures that only authorized personnel can access critical resources.
- Regular Security Audits: Conducting periodic audits helps identify vulnerabilities and facilitates timely remediation strategies.
Multi-Cloud Strategies with Thabet Solutions
The adoption of multi-cloud strategies is becoming increasingly relevant, as it allows businesses to leverage the strengths of different cloud providers while enhancing resilience and performance. Thabet facilitates seamless integration across multiple cloud platforms, enabling organizations to avoid vendor lock-in and optimize costs. Here are some strategies to consider:
- Data Portability: Ensuring data can move freely between different cloud providers enhances flexibility and responsiveness.
- Disaster Recovery: Leveraging multiple clouds can provide failover capabilities, ensuring systems remain operational in the event of a provider failure.
- Workload Distribution: Distributing workloads based on the most cost-effective and performance-optimized environments can significantly enhance efficiency.
AI/ML Integration with Thabet: Elevating Business Potential
As businesses strive to harness the power of artificial intelligence and machine learning, integrating these technologies into Thabet methodologies becomes paramount. Leveraging AI/ML can drive substantial business benefits, from enhanced customer experiences to streamlined operations.
Machine Learning Models Powered by Thabet
The development of machine learning models is supported through Thabet frameworks, enabling businesses to leverage data effectively:
- Predictive Analytics: Utilizing historical data to forecast trends, helping companies make informed operational decisions.
- Natural Language Processing (NLP): Implementing NLP techniques enhances customer interactions through chatbots and automated response systems.
- Image Recognition: Leveraging deep learning for image analysis to support industries like e-commerce in product recommendations.
Data Processing Pipelines in AI for Thabet
Robust data processing pipelines are essential for AI systems; Thabet strategies outline the best practices for ensuring data quality and accessibility:
- ETL Processes: Efficient Extract, Transform, Load (ETL) processes enable seamless data integration from diverse sources.
- Real-Time Data Processing: Implementing tools like Apache Kafka facilitates real-time analytics, allowing for timely decision-making.
- Data Governance: Establishing clear governance protocols ensures data integrity, compliance, and security.
Ethics in AI: Ensuring Responsible Thabet Deployment
As AI technologies evolve, responsible deployment is critical. Businesses leveraging Thabet must address ethical considerations:
- Bias Mitigation: Implementing strategies to ensure algorithms are free from bias and promote fairness.
- Transparency: Maintaining transparency with stakeholders about how AI systems make decisions.
- Accountability: Establishing frameworks for accountability in AI deployments enhances trust and compliance.
Cybersecurity Measures for Thabet Applications
Cybersecurity remains a crucial aspect for organizations utilizing Thabet architectures. With increasing cyber threats, businesses must prioritize robust security measures to protect their assets and data.
Identifying Threats: Thabet’s Approach to Mitigation
Thabet’s framework emphasizes proactive threat identification strategies:
- Vulnerability Scanning: Regular scans can help identify and remediate vulnerabilities before exploitation.
- Threat Intelligence: Utilizing threat intelligence feeds allows organizations to stay ahead of emerging threats.
- Incident Response Plan: Developing a comprehensive incident response plan guarantees rapid action in case of breaches.
Robust Encryption Techniques in Thabet Services
Data encryption is foundational to Thabet’s security protocols:
- End-to-End Encryption: Protects data by encrypting it at the sender’s end and only decrypting it at the receiver’s end.
- Public Key Infrastructure (PKI): A PKI system ensures that communication between endpoints remains secure and authenticated.
- Data Tokenization: Replacing sensitive data with non-sensitive tokens mitigates risk in data breaches.
Compliance Standards: Keeping Thabet Secure
Ensuring compliance with industry standards is vital for maintaining security:
- GDPR Compliance: Proper data handling practices must be in place to meet regulations set forth by GDPR.
- PCI DSS: For organizations dealing with payment information, adherence to PCI DSS is non-negotiable.
- ISO Standards: Implementing ISO/IEC 27001 provides a framework for managing and protecting sensitive information.
Emerging Technologies and the Future of Thabet
The landscape of technology is always evolving, and Thabet is poised to adapt and thrive within it. Emerging technologies are set to redefine collaborative tools and change how software is developed and deployed.
Quantum Computing: What It Means for Thabet
As quantum computing emerges, it poses both challenges and opportunities for Thabet methodologies:
- Enhanced Processing Power: Quantum computers could provide significant boosts in computational capabilities, impacting data-heavy AI/ML tasks.
- New Algorithm Development: New algorithms designed for quantum systems may redefine optimization problems and cryptographic practices.
- Adaptation Strategies: Businesses must remain agile and innovative to leverage quantum computing advancements.
Thabet in Edge Computing: Enhancing Performance
With the growth of IoT and real-time applications, edge computing remains critical for Thabet solutions:
- Lower Latency: Processing data closer to where it is generated reduces latency, crucial for time-sensitive applications.
- Bandwidth Efficiency: Minimizing data transmission to central servers optimizes bandwidth usage, improving overall system performance.
- Increased Privacy: Edge computing enables local data processing, enhancing user privacy and compliance.
Trends in Web3 Technologies Relevant to Thabet
Web3 technologies are transforming how businesses engage with users and process transactions:
- Decentralized Applications (dApps): These applications can enhance resilience and eliminate single points of failure.
- Smart Contracts: Automated agreements reduce the need for intermediaries and improve transaction efficiency.
- Blockchain Integration: Securing data integrity within Thabet solutions can be achieved through blockchain technologies, ensuring transparency and security.
FAQs
What is the significance of Thabet in modern software?
Thabet represents an innovative approach to software development, integrating best practices that ensure scalability, efficiency, and sustainable practices in technology solutions.
How does Thabet address cybersecurity challenges?
Thabet emphasizes proactive threat identification, incorporating robust encryption techniques, and ensuring compliance with necessary data protection regulations to mitigate cybersecurity risks.
What trends can we expect for Thabet in 2026?
As we look towards 2026, advancements in quantum computing, edge computing, and Web3 technologies will likely inform the development and evolution of Thabet solutions, enhancing their capabilities and potential applications across various sectors.